Lawnbott Evolution

The Lawnbott Evolution is a robotic lawnmower designed for use by individuals with mobility, walking, balance or lower extremity disabilities, arthritis, or spinal cord injury. This mower is designed to cut grass without human involvement. It mows, returns to the charger, and goes back out to mow when needed, all automatically. This mower is designed to handle 33,000 square feet of yard, or more than one acre of actual grass, and up to a 27-degree slope. The unit is self-programming, and as it mows it determines the resistance of the grass and the size of the yard to calculate the next time it needs to go out and mow again. This mower also features Smart Spiral that it enables it to detect areas where the grass is growing faster or thicker than other areas, such as around sprinkler heads or septic tanks. When such an area is detected, the mower will start in a tight circular pattern and work its way out to ensure a smooth yard. It can also mow in three zones. The device is also equipped with a rain sensor. An infrared remote is also included; a press of a button returns the mower to the charger. OPTIONS: Perimeter wire, replacement dome nut, spiked tires, transformer cover, and others. POWER: Uses a rechargeable lithium ion battery to cover 1.5 acre lot with one battery or approximately a 2 acre lot with an optional second battery. A winter recharge kit is included. WARRANTY: Two- year warranty
